Transaction 94a4edac807a5f32082155105d9f3541e390765257229c6182c45b406f8ae209
1 Input
1 Output
-
94a4edac807a5f32082155105d9f3541e390765257229c6182c45b406f8ae209:0
- value
- 37595153
- script pubkey
- OP_0 OP_PUSHBYTES_20 31d4e899b5516f5205acf54608faa33a6701eb5e
- address
- bc1qx82w3xd429h4ypdv74rq374r8fnsr667cjjh8m